Description

  • Understands the strategy of the Service Division and provide relevant financial insight into performance developing expertise over time.
  • Interprets and explains financial performance within the Service Division.
  • Researches and presents dynamic industry, competitor and economic contexts.
  • Ensures the provision of accurate, relevant and timely management information.
  • Supports the development and analysis of the financial and commercial aspects of Division specific capital projects.
  • Responsible for the production of the Division level monthly Management Accounts adding commentary, including student income and expenditure.
  • Review performance analysis and trends of both individuals, including reviewing indirect income against targets and sources of funding.
  • Review of organisations Facilities to assess their financial viability for both new and existing unit.
  • Provide effective support, advice and control of the financial and commercial aspects of grants and contracts in both application and delivery phases.
  • To be an advocate for delivery of internal Customer Service.
  • Deputising as relevant for the line manager by attending relevant boards and meetings with groups with contribution to relevant decision making.
  • Provide training on relevant financial rules and regulations to all areas of the organisation.
  • To host discussion groups to identify new opportunities and developments within each of the areas of responsibility, to consider options for consideration and potential systems developments.
  • Provides financial leadership to the Division and assist in determining strategic direction and aligning financial strategies to this
  • Support the development of financial budgets, plans and strategies and their effective implementation for the Services Divisions that they support.
